Some quotes from the latest XXL Magazine, in stores now:


Afeni Shakur added that she buried Tupac&#39;s ashes on her farm in Lumberton, North Carolina, saying, "Yesterday, which was June 16, 2003, we put Tupac&#39;s ashes in the ground after seven years... And we pray that people will allow him to be gone. I think we should let him be. He earned it."
I wonder why she finally buried Tupac&#39;s ashes after seven years? There&#39;s that "7" theory again.

She continued, "Once they tried to take Tupac out of the coma, and Tupac started to fight, we believe that Tupac was not interested. Tupac died seven times and they revived him seven times, and then I asked the doctors to allow him to be. And that&#39;s what we did. We let him be."
There is the "7" theory again. Saying he died seven times, and he was brought back to life seven times.
